zoukankan      html  css  js  c++  java
  • 数据库

    前提下载安装好mysql,

      先数据库,再表,再有数据        

    登入数据库mysql -u root –p

    数据库管理;

            Show databases; 查询所有的数据库

    创建数据库

      Create database+(自定义库名)

    create database mydb2 character set utf8; 创建utf-8字符集的数据库(存中文

    查看数据库)

    Show databases; 查询所有的数据库

    show create database mydb01; 查询名叫mydb01的数据库

    删除数据库

    drop database mydb02;删除名为mydb02的数据库

    修改数据库

      alter database mydb1;修改名为mydb1的数据库(默认为拉丁文)

     alter database mydb1 character  set  utf8;

       表管理

    选择数据库Use+(库名);

    use mydb01;

    查看所有表

    show tables;

    创建表

    create table user (

        -> id int,

        -> uname varchar(20),

        -> paw varchar(20)

      ->);

             查看表结构

    desc +表的名字;

    删除表

    drop table+表名;

    删除表:drop table 表名;

              修改表名称:alter table 旧表名 rename to 新表名;

    添加字段:alter table 表名add column 字段名 类型;

              删除字段:alter table 表名 drop column字段名;

              修改字段类型:alter table 表名 modify column 字段名 类型varchar(10);

              修改字段名称:alter table 表名 change column 旧字段名 新字段名 类型(varchar(30));

  • 相关阅读:
    线段树区间最大子段和
    NTT数论变换
    cdq分治·三维偏序问题
    线段树区间开方
    怎么联系$zcy$呢?
    题解 CF375D 【Tree and Queries】
    点分治模板
    Good Bye 2018题解
    Hello 2019题解
    Codeforces Round #525 (Div. 2)题解
  • 原文地址:https://www.cnblogs.com/layuechuquwan/p/11186823.html
Copyright © 2011-2022 走看看